    In this episode of The Crazy House Prices Podcast, I break down what happens after a sale is agreed upon in Ireland, drawing from my book "How to Buy a Home in Ireland." I cover the crucial steps following a 'sale-agreed' status, such as notifying your solicitor, paying a booking deposit, arranging a pre-purchase survey, and securing mortgage protection and home insurance. I highlight that 'sale-agreed' is non-binding, meaning the deal isn't final until contracts are signed, and discuss common hurdles like probate, structural surveys, and potential renegotiations of the sale price.

    I share a checklist for buyers, including the importance of clear communication with solicitors and estate agents, and preparing for potential delays. The episode also touches on the often frustrating, slow pace of the buying process due to factors like bank delays and the complexity of probate.     In this episode of "The Crazy House Prices Podcast," I delve into the extra costs of buying a home in Ireland, a key topic from my book "How to Buy a Home in Ireland." I cover essential expenses beyond the deposit, such as stamp duty, solicitor and valuer fees, property tax, home and mortgage protection insurance, and moving costs.

    Listeners will gain insights into managing these additional costs, with advice on budgeting effectively. I recommend saving 12%-13% of the home's purchase price to comfortably cover these expenses. The episode offers practical tips, including considerations for stamp duty, the importance of a comprehensive surveyor’s report, and the advantages of alarm systems like Ring.
